Charlotte Street (Bar)
27 April 2008
The frontage of the Charlotte Street Hotel beautifies the street it is on. The room in which the bar and restaurant are located is gorgeous and airy. However, the wait staff entirely negate all of the positives. They are dismissive, greet you poorly (if at all) and basically make you feel like you're an imposition in their own private space. Bar staff are quite helpful and pleasant and the food is nice. I really want to patronise this beautiful place, but after each visit I wonder why I keep trying.

Third Space (Gym)
10 September 2005
A great gym with excellent facilities. Stunning architectural features on every level and lots of natural lighting makes this place a great 'home away from home'. There is a wide range of equipment and a great boxing area with lots of pros and skilled trainers that seem pretty happy to help.
The floatation tank is in a very strange place (will never use it that publicly). Pool is beautiful but a little short and a tad too warm.
Nevertheless, I think it's a great gym in a great location and definitely unrivaled in London.
